January 1st
New Year’s Day in Paris, afternoon stroll around one of our favourite areas “la Butte aux Cailles” – one of those typically Parisian areas that feels like a small village. Paris is so annoyingly pleasing in that respect, distinct and different quartiers that feel like villages in their own right. La Butte aux Cailles is in the 13th arrondissement, just a short walk from the bustle of the Place d’Italie. Today all is calm and this graffiti on a wall just sums it all up.
